At Capital City College Group (CCCG) we are dedicated to transforming lives through exceptional education and training. Our focus is providing our learners with the skills to be successful in their futures, whether that is continuing in education through higher education, or an apprenticeship, or supporting them into a higher-level job. We are the largest community of college in London, and one of the largest in the UK, with three fantastic colleges, City and Islington College, Westminster Kingsway College and College of Haringey, Enfield and North East London.

We are currently building a talent pool for hourly paid GCSE English and Maths staff to support our educational programs. We have work available across all our sites including, Angel, Finsbury Park, Holloway, Tottenham, Enfield, Victoria, Westminister and Regents Park.
